A member of Congress cannot be removed from office by impeachment. However, a member of Congress CAN be removed from office by 2/3 majority vote of their chamber.

Article I, Section 5, Clause 2 of the Constitution says: "Each House may determine the Rules of its Proceedings, punish its Members for disorderly Behaviour, and, with the Concurrence of two thirds, expel a Member."
